Warning Signs You Need Roof Leak Water Removal
Don’t ignore the warning signs of a roof leak, catch them early to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of a roof leak. If you notice musty smells in your attic, walls, or ceilings, it’s time to call our team. We’ll investigate the source of the odor and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a roof leak. If you notice brown or yellow stains, it’s time to call our team. We’ll investigate the source of the leak and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of a roof leak. If you notice uneven or damaged flooring, it’s time to call our team. We’ll investigate the source of the leak and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of a roof leak. If you notice peeling or bubbling paint or wallpaper, it’s time to call our team. We’ll investigate the source of the leak and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ks in your home can be a sign of a roof leak. If you notice dripping water or strange noises coming from your ceiling or walls, it’s time to call our team. We’ll investigate the source of the leak and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Roof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a single room |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small, isolated leaks. Call a pro for larger or more complex issues. |
| Large leak affecting multiple rooms | No | Yes | Large leaks need profess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ough restoration process. |
| Leaks in hard-to-reach areas (e.g., attic, crawl space) | No | Yes | Leaks in hard-to-reach areas need specialized equipment and expertise to access and repair. |
| Leaks causing structural damage (e.g., warped flooring, buckled walls) | No | Yes | Leaks causing structural damage need immediate profess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living environment. |

Common Questions About Roof Leak Water Removal
Q: What causes roof leaks?
A: Roof le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including damaged or missing shingles, clogged gutters, and ice dams. Our team will investigate the source of the leak and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Q: How long does the water removal process take?
A: The water removal process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the amount of water present. Our team will work efficiently to extract as much water as possible and dry out your property.

Q: Can I prevent roof leaks?
A: Yes, you can prevent roof leaks by maintaining your roof regularly, including cleaning gutters and downspouts, inspecting for damaged or missing shingles, and repairing any damage quickly. Our team can provide a customized maintenance plan to keep your roof in top condition.
